FYI, from TI about how datasheets.

Thank you for your inquiry regarding posting TI datasheets to news groups. Duplication of TI documentation, such as posting it to newsgroups or websites, is a violation of TI's copyright policy. We understand that users often need such information, but users should direct their inquiries to TI controlled or approved sources for information about TI products, including obsolete devices. TI's website has a search engine that allows user's to search for product information, including datasheets. For obsolete product information that may not be available through the TI website, TI has approved sources for obtaining that information. All inquires regarding TI product information should be directed to TI's Product Information Center to ensure that such information is accurate and/or current.
